Output 18b9c27c3ee26d03a6075a439b850ce955a080d5ad264e9da027fd5b29b90181:1

value
3406338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 406552ba2994231318f5a836138ba090061ccac5 OP_EQUAL
address
37ZWYspUmgqf3WDjAo61PXdbmE1REN4skX
transaction
18b9c27c3ee26d03a6075a439b850ce955a080d5ad264e9da027fd5b29b90181
confirmations
438632
spent
true